It is frequently thought that music has a chance to have an effect on our feelings, intellect, and psychology; it may assuage our loneliness or incite our passions. The philosopher Plato indicates inside the Republic that music provides a immediate impact on the soul. Therefore, he proposes that in the ideal routine music can be intently controlled by the state (E-book VII).

In some musical contexts, a performance or composition may very well be to some extent improvised. For illustration, in Hindustani classical music, the performer plays spontaneously while next a partly outlined construction and applying characteristic motifs. In modal jazz, the performers may choose turns foremost and responding while sharing a transforming list of notes. Inside of a cost-free jazz context, there might be no construction in anyway, with Each and every performer acting at their discretion.

People composing music in 2013 applying electronic keyboards and computers "Composition" is the act or follow of making a music, an instrumental music piece, a piece with each singing and instruments, or One more variety of music. In several cultures, such as Western classical music, the act of composing also contains the development of music notation, like a sheet music "score", and that is then executed via the composer or by other singers or musicians. In popular music and standard music, the act of composing, which is typically referred to as songwriting, may possibly require the development of a simple outline from the song, called the guide sheet, which sets out the melody, lyrics and chord development.
